Shinjuku

Major commercial hub with the bustling Shinjuku Station, Tokyo Metropolitan Government Building, and various attractions like Kabukichō, Golden Gai, and Shinjuku Gyoen. Shop at flagship stores and enjoy diverse dining options.

Shibuya

Major commercial and finance hub, Shibuya boasts bustling railway stations, trendy fashion scenes in Harajuku and Omotesandō, and vibrant nightlife. Don't miss the iconic Shibuya Crossing and Hachikō statue.

Ginza

Upscale shopping and luxurious dining await in this elegant district, featuring flagship fashion stores, art galleries, and the renowned Sukiyabashi Jiro sushi restaurant. Catch a kabuki performance at Kabuki-za theater or stroll through pedestrian heaven on weekends.

Asakusa

Discover Sensō-ji, a renowned Buddhist temple, and savor traditional Japanese cuisine at local eateries. Explore Kappabashi-dori for kitchenware, cruise the Sumida River, and stay in a cozy ryokan near the Tokyo Metro Ginza Line subway.

Ueno

Try the hanami tradition of admiring flowers as you walk past cherry blossoms and delve into the history of this area through its museums and ornate temples.

  • Tokyo Skytree: Standing at 634 meters, Tokyo Skytree is the tallest structure in Japan, offering breathtaking panoramic views of the city. The observation decks provide a stunning perspective of Tokyo's skyline, especially at sunset. The surrounding area features shopping and dining options, perfect for a full day of exploration.
  • Sensoji Temple: As Tokyo's oldest temple, Sensoji Temple embodies rich cultural traditions and history. The vibrant Nakamise Street leading to the temple is lined with shops selling traditional snacks and souvenirs, creating a lively atmosphere. The serene temple grounds offer a peaceful contrast to the bustling city.
  • Tokyo Imperial Palace: The main residence of the Emperor of Japan, the Tokyo Imperial Palace is surrounded by beautiful gardens and historic architecture. Visitors can explore the East Gardens, which are open to the public, and experience the tranquility of this historic site, reflecting Japan's imperial heritage.

Best time to go to Nishinippori

The best time to visit Nishinippori is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January41.9°F (5.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February43.3°F (6.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March50.2°F (10.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
April57.7°F (14.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
May66.6°F (19.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June72.0°F (22.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July79.3°F (26.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August81.9°F (27.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
September75.7°F (24.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
October66.0°F (18.9°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
November57.0°F (13.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December46.9°F (8.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Nishinippori

Traveling to Nishinippori, Tokyo, is convenient with access to three major airports. Tokyo Haneda Airport (HND) is approximately 20.9km away, with nearby hotels like The Prince Park Tower Tokyo and Grand Hyatt Tokyo, both about 12.9km from the airport. Transportation services include scheduled airport shuttles and fee-based transport options. Tokyo Narita Airport (NRT) is around 56.3km from Nishinippori, and good hotel choices include Hotel Nikko Narita and ANA Crowne Plaza Narita, both just about 1.6km away. Lastly, Ibaraki Airport (IBR) is 75.6km away, with hotels like Mito Plaza Hotel located 19.3km from the airport, providing various accommodation options for your stay.
